R语言使用备忘

来源:互联网 发布:可乐谢安琪歌词知乎 编辑:程序博客网 时间:2024/06/03 12:43

1.下载包时突然发现:

> install.packages("Rserve")
警告: 无法在貯藏處https://cran.cnr.berkeley.edu/bin/windows/contrib/3.1中读写索引
警告信息:
package ‘Rserve’ is not available (as a binary package for R version 3.1.3) 

解决方法:使用其他镜像:

> chooseCRANmirror()
> install.packages("Rserve")
试开URL’http://mirrors.tuna.tsinghua.edu.cn/CRAN/bin/windows/contrib/3.1/Rserve_1.7-3.zip'
Content type 'application/zip' length 713169 bytes (696 KB)
打开了URL
downloaded 696 KB
程序包‘Rserve’打开成功,MD5和检查也通过
下载的二进制程序包在
        C:\Users\jiaxi\AppData\Local\Temp\Rtmp0wMTBJ\downloaded_packages里

2.rnorm是正态分布函数,dnorm是正态分布密度函数,pnorm是其密度函数的积分函数,如何验证?

答:可以通过直方图来看

x=rnorm(1000)

hist(x)

x=seq(-10,10,length.out=100)
y=dnorm(x)
plot(x,y)


y=pnorm(x)
plot(x,y)

3.启用可以远程连接的rserver模式: R CMD Rserve --RS-enable-remote

4.查看端口被什么进程占用:netstat -apn,

5.什么什么的,没搞懂:

hadoop@10.201.76.86 /opt/rh/devtoolset-2/root/usr/bin/ 开发者工具
yum软件仓库配置:/etc/yum.repos.d

6./tmp/RtmpcxmX8a/downloaded_packages 这是R下载包的存放目录

7.手动安装r包R CMD INSTALL -l libpath package.tar.gz

如: R CMD INSTALL -l /home/hadoop/R/x86_64-unknown-linux-gnu-library/3.1 /tmp/RtmpcxmX8a/downloaded_packages/forecast_6.0.tar.gz

8.一些参考资料https://cran.r-project.org/doc/manuals/r-release/R-admin.html#Installation

9.算法包:https://cran.r-project.org/src/contrib/Archive/forecast/

10.安装本地算法包并且自动安装依赖包

install.packages("/tmp/RtmpcxmX8a/downloaded_packages/forecast_6.0.tar.gz",dependencies=TRUE,lib="/home/hadoop/R/x86_64-unknown-linux-gnu-library/3.1")
11.常用的命令
查看包详情:library(help='包名')
查看已安装的包:installed.packages()
安装包:install.packages('包名')
查看当前环境下的对象:ls()
对象长度:length()
查看对象类型:mode(对象)
产生序列:seq(from,to,step)详情用help(方法)查看

重复对象:rep(对象,重复次数)

产生时间序列:seq(from=as.Date("2016-09-22"),by=1,length.out=12)

生成间隔为30分钟的时间序列:strptime("2016-01-01 00:00:00","%Y-%m-%d %H:%M:%S")+900*0:95

查看对象方法:method(对象)

查看对象类型:class(对象)

更多查看 http://blog.csdn.net/lilanfeng1991/article/details/18408451

0 0
原创粉丝点击